  • Abstract
    This paper presents a comparative analysis between conventional switched reluctance motor (SRM) and mutually coupled SRM (MCSRM) for equal copper losses. Copper winding volume and electrical resistance per phase are calculated based on SOLIDWORKSTM analysis. The proposed method will enable the designers to accurately estimate the phase resistance ahead of the machine construction. In the final part, the electrical and magnetic characteristics of both machines are compared, based on MAXWELL 2D results
